Eugene Smakhtin

3×3 · top 25.6% of 284,439 all-time · competing since March 2009 · 2009SMAK01

Eugene Smakhtin has been competing for 18 years. His best event is the 3×3: a personal-best single of 15.36, set at Eka Cube Days 2019, puts him in the top 25.6% of the 284,439 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 1,300th in Russia. Across 2 competitions since March 2009, he has put 20 official solves on the record across two events. His 3×3 best has come down from 27.11 in March 2009 to 15.36, a 43% improvement. Eugene has entered two competitions.
